Yes I normally have the show window content while dragging option on in the 
windows control panel.  I did turn it off -- same thing but the freezing occurs 
when you drop the window and it's not as frequent -- meaning sometimes 
immediate -- sometimes you need several drops.

Problem also seems somewhat intermitant.  Usually freezes immediately -- but 
sometimes you can start OO and not have the problem for awhile.  This happened 
to me one today.

When I turned off the show content while dragging I noticed something else 
too.  The navigator window usually opens flush left and 4 or 5 pixels from 
flush top of the master window.  With the show window content off I was able to 
get the navigator window into the center of the screen and try sizing.  If you 
size from the top or left edges the applications seems to freeze but from the 
right and bottom edges it does not.
